Job Description

Performing subsequent examination of the cause or causes of failure on failed components/parts using analytical laboratory techniques.
Responsibilities include: sample preparation, cross-sectioning, chemical de-capsulation of electronic devices etc, perform component level failure analysis for internal and external customers, interpretation and communication of analysis data from performed test. Coordination with internal and external engineering teams involved in product support and generation of written FA reports. This role requires strong knowledge in materials behavior, characterization, failure modes, and degradation mechanisms as well as duplication of failure modes. Familiarity with the following materials is desirable- Metals and alloys (solder and soldering products), polymers, composites, coatings, adhesives. Experiences with SEM, FTIR, IC tester, CMM, TDR and other Part lab instruments are required. Coordinate troubleshooting of the electronics to the component level and electrical failure characterization.
Perform detail-oriented, timeline driven work with extreme accuracy.
Familiarity with industry standards IPC-TM-650 , IPC/J STD is a must.

Requirements
BS/MS EE/ME/Material Science or other related engineering discipline with 5-7 years experience and hands-on failure analysis of electronic and mechanical components. Must be skilled at sample preparation, cross-sectioning, polarized light microscopy and x-ray analysis. Chemical de-capsulation of electronic devices and hands-on experience with SEM, EDS, FTIR, C-SAM, TDR required. Ability to work well in a fast-paced professional environment.
Strong verbal and written communication skills including technical report writing and presentations.
